This market will resolve according to the player that finishes Round 1 of the main tournament at the 2026 Irish Open with the lowest cumulative score to par. In the event of a tie, this market will resolve in favor of the player with the lower score on the back 9 of the first round. If a tie still persists, this market will resolve in favor of the player that records more eagles thus far in the main tournament. If a tie still persists, this market will resolve in favor of the player who records more birdies thus far in the main tournament. If a tie still persists, this market will resolve in favor of the player who records fewer bogeys thus far in the main tournament. If a tie still persists, this market will resolve in favor of the player whose listed last name comes first alphabetically. If the 2026 Irish Open is cancelled, postponed after September 27, 2026 at 11:59PM ET, or if an official Round 1 leader has not been declared within that timeframe, this market will resolve to "Other". The primary resolution source will be the official results published by the event organizer or governing body.The first-round leader market at the 2026 Irish Open reflects a tightly bunched field at Trump International Doonbeg, a new links venue where limited prior course knowledge and variable Atlantic winds create scoring volatility. A deep roster featuring major winners such as Jon Rahm, Brooks Koepka, and defending champion Rory McIlroy alongside consistent DP World Tour performers like Adrian Meronk, Alejandro Del Rey, and Matt Wallace means no single player holds a pronounced edge after 18 holes. Links demands for accuracy off the tee, strong short-game execution, and adaptability to firm, fast conditions further level the probabilities, as recent form on similar layouts and current ball-striking trends offer only modest differentiation. Trader consensus prices each of the leading names near even-money implied odds because any low round from the 100-plus strong contingent remains plausible on Thursday.
